Help Patients Take the First OTC Proton Pump Inhibitor Appropriately
February 2019
Nexium 24HR (esomeprazole) will move out from behind pharmacy counters...and raise questions about appropriate PPI use.
It's the first PPI to switch from Schedule II to III. This means patients will self-select it from your professional products area.
Be prepared to answer questions about appropriate use of PPIs.
